javascript - 是否可以使用innerHTML 插入@Html.DisplayFor?
问题描述
这是我的 JS 代码的一部分:
switch (selectedOptionIndex) {
case 0:
finalChoice.innerHTML = '@Html.TextBoxFor(modelItem => item.ManualDate, new { @type = "date", @class = "form-control datepicker"})'
break;
case 1:
finalChoice.innerHTML = '@Html.TextBoxFor(modelItem => item.ManualDate, new { @type = "date", @class = "form-control datepicker"})'
break;
不幸的是,浏览器将其呈现为字符串。是否可以使用 JS 将此部分添加到我的视图中?
解决方案
推荐阅读
- mongodb - WebStorm - 启动“Mongod”工具后运行默认配置?
- reactjs - 如何在 React 中处理多页 JSON 响应的调度
- android - 是否可以检查电话号码是否已在 Firebase 中注册,否则请转到注册
- sql - 需要帮助从查询中删除最后一个逗号
- loops - addEventListener 不会触发
- 在 for 循环中
- javascript - 按下按钮时反应本机加载数据
- css - 如何在 Oracle APEX 5 中添加自定义 css 字体图标
- javascript - Vue js将子渲染器作为道具传递的最佳方式
- react-native - 当我在我的 android 设备上使用 Psiphon 时,我的 react-native 应用程序请求出现网络错误
- c - 不按回车就可以知道用户写了什么?